Manitoba is adding eight beds over the next three years to support patients going through substance addiction withdrawal.
The additional community-residential withdrawal management beds will include four for men at Winnipeg's Main Street Project, and four women's beds at the Addictions Foundation of Manitoba's (AFM) River Point Centre in Winnipeg, a Tuesday news release from the province says.
